Is 33 713 150 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 33 713 150 is about 5 806.303.

Thus, the square root of 33 713 150 is not an integer, and therefore 33 713 150 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 33 713 150?

The square of a number (here 33 713 150) is the result of the product of this number (33 713 150) by itself (i.e., 33 713 150 × 33 713 150); the square of 33 713 150 is sometimes called "raising 33 713 150 to the power 2", or "33 713 150 squared".

The square of 33 713 150 is 1 136 576 482 922 500 because 33 713 150 × 33 713 150 = 33 713 1502 = 1 136 576 482 922 500.

As a consequence, 33 713 150 is the square root of 1 136 576 482 922 500.
